Open Access BPO runs a children’s outreach drive

DAVAO, PHILIPPINES — Open Access BPO has shifted its Davao community outreach from a biennial schedule to an annual commitment as the program enters its fourth year, building on past initiatives that have included a remote school, a dog shelter, and tree planting, according to the company.
Balay Pasilungan staff shaped the donation list
Open Access BPO, a business process outsourcing (BPO) company with operations in Davao since 2015, sent 20 volunteers from its first Davao site to the Foundation of Balay Pasilungan on June 4, delivering clothes and undergarments for each of 18 children under 18, a month’s supply of milk and chocolate drinks, games, and a meal on the day.
Before the drive, Balay Pasilungan staff specified what the children needed, and Open Access donated to that list rather than deciding independently.
According to the company’s website, its first Davao location has operated with more than 200 staff since its 2015 opening, making the 20-person volunteer group a meaningful share of that base.
Annual commitment follows four years of Davao outreach
Open Access BPO has run community outreach in Davao for four years, shifting from a biennial to an annual cadence as the program formalizes its place in the company’s operations.
Past programs have included building a remote school, supporting a dog shelter, and running a tree planting drive.
The company’s Davao footprint expanded in November 2023 when it added a second site at Matina IT Park, giving future programs a broader volunteer base.
